I my be wrong and I often am, but I can not remember Brett ever being"BOOOed" in Green Bay.

Now I mean really booed like he was today in New York, especially after his 7th interception in 3 games and the third of today's game which went 91 yards for a T.D. and a KC Lead late in the game.

Brett said in an interview after today's game: "I heard them before in Green Bay."

Does anyone remember Packer fans really letting him have it? I don't. I always thought Packer fans at Lambeau worshiped him, even when he did throw some picks.

If not.... Why would he say that?

In his earlier years in Green Bay he was booed. After his first MVP I do not recall him ever being booed. Normally we would just say he's a gunslinger. He'd throw some miracle passes, but also some 'wtf' passes. We took the good with the bad.
